Oando PLC is an African-focused integrated energy company with material upstream oil and gas production, strategic gas and petroleum trading infrastructure, and a fast-growing energy transition platform spanning power and clean energy solutions.

Equity Proposition

Oando is Nigeria’s leading indigenous energy group with operations spanning upstream exploration and production, trading and clean energy. Listed on both the Nigerian Exchange and the Johannesburg Stock Exchange, the company has a market capitalisation of approximately $490m and an ambition to reach approximately 100,000  barrels of oil per day and 1.5bn cubic feet of gas per day gross production by 2030.

1. The NAOC acquisition has been transformational.

Production growth is accelerating following the transformational NAOC acquisition in 2024, which significantly strengthened the company’s position in Nigeria’s upstream sector. The transaction doubled Oando’s interest in the OML 60–63 joint venture to 40% and granted operatorship of these prolific assets. Operator status has enhanced execution flexibility, enabling improved uptime, targeted infrastructure upgrades and a more active development approach. As a result, production from these licences averaged 40,077 barrels of oil equivalent per day in the first half of 2026, up from 33,947 in the prior year. The group production averaged 42,789 barrels of oil equivalent per day for H126, representing 16% year-on-year growth across crude oil, gas and natural gas liquids. Beyond immediate production gains, the acquisition also materially expanded Oando’s asset and infrastructure footprint, including 52 discovered oil and gas fields, production and processing facilities, an oil terminal and power plants, while boosting total reserves to approximately one billion barrels of oil equivalent. The company is positioned for sustained production growth through its multi-year development programme. The goal is to reach approximately 100,000 barrels of oil per day and 1.5bn cubic feet of gas per day gross production by 2030.

2. Half-year financial performance demonstrated resilience.

Despite market headwinds, Oando delivered a resilient financial performance in the first half of 2026.

The company’s strong cash flow performance during the year was the main highlight of the results. The company generated positive net cash flow from operations of $80m, supported by stronger upstream contributions and tighter working capital management, with cash and cash equivalents more than doubling to $396m at period end. At the same time, capital expenditure increased significantly to $81m, with 2026 guidance between $90m and $100m, underscoring the company’s commitment to upstream development and facility integrity.

3. Oando is selectively diversifying across the energy value chain.

Beyond upstream, Oando’s trading division increased activity in crude oil cargo and is expanding into gas and metals trading. The clean energy segment continues to advance selected initiatives in electric mobility and solar manufacturing. Meanwhile, the mining division continues to advance a diversified portfolio across tin, lithium, gold and bitumen, with a focus on progressing priority assets towards commercialisation, including through strategic state-backed partnerships. The company recently expanded its African upstream portfolio with a successful bid for Block KON 13 in Angola, securing a 45% participating interest and operatorship. The asset is strategically located in the prolific Kwanza onshore basin, which holds significant exploration potential.

4. The balance sheet is being restructured to unlock long-term equity value.

Oando is executing a comprehensive capital restructuring programme aimed at resolving legacy balance sheet constraints, improving cash-flow resilience and restoring flexibility for growth and capital market access. The focus is on simplifying the capital structure, extending maturities and aligning debt service with the cash generating profile of the enlarged asset base; allowing management greater scope to direct capital towards the highest return assets as production scales towards the 2030 targets.
